WebFish is the 3rd episode of the 8th Season . Summary The fishermen have caught a huge catch of fish, Sir Topham Hatt sends Thomas to help Arthur at the Fishing Village. When Thomas arrives, he sees a very long line of cars waiting for him. WebFish is the 102nd episode of Thomas and Friends.
